Alexis Vuillemin, a graduate of the École des Ponts et Chaussées, has been appointed Secretary-General of the Ministry for Ecological Transition by a decree dated 31 August 2026, published in the Official Journal on 1 September.

He succeeds Guillaume Leforestier, who has held the post since January 2022.

Alexis Vuillemin is a graduate of the École Polytechnique and the École nationale des ponts et chaussées, and holds an MBA from the Collège des ingénieurs. During his career, he served as deputy chief of staff to the Minister for Ecological Transition (2022-2024), then as chief of staff to the Minister of State for Transport.
